Some of you might have noticed some upcoming patches for Firefox for Android relating to a Mozilla-run geo-location service. If you are interested in the backstory of this service or wonder what it is about, come join us in our new mailing list at: https://lists.mozilla.org/listinfo/dev-geolocation or read up on some more details at: https://wiki.mozilla.org/Services/Location For immediate feedback, join us in IRC on the #geo channel, with a better chance for responses during European work hours. I'd expect the mailing list to have a technical focus. But it should also be a place, where we can discuss the broader policy / legal aspects of it, to the degree where these can be discussed in the open. At this point the mailing list is primarily about the new Mozilla-hosted geolocation project. But I'd be happy to see discussions from the existing "Core :: Geolocation" bugzilla component on the same mailing list.
